(mysql)update同时更新多个表
(1)
同时更新的多个表之间没关系的:
?
use mytest;CREATE TABLE tb(id int ,data varchar(20));insert tb values(1,'aaa');insert tb values(2,'bbb');insert tb values(3,'ccc');use test;CREATE TABLE tb(id int ,data varchar(20));insert tb values(1,'aaa');insert tb values(2,'bbb');insert tb values(3,'ccc');UPDATE mytest.tb,test.tb SET mytest.tb.data='liangCK', test.tb.data='liangCK'WHERE mytest.tb.id=test.tb.id AND mytest.tb.id=2;
http://blog.163.com/wangkangming2008@126/blog/static/7827792820098941210766/